Evaluating Real Time Finite Temperature Feynman Amplitudes
M.E. Carrington🇨🇦 · Hou Defu🇨🇦 · A. Hachkowski🇨🇦 · D. Pickering🇨🇦 · J.C. Sowiak🇨🇦
Abstract
We construct a program to calculate Feynman amplitudes at finite temperature in the real time Keldysh formalism using the symbolic manipulation program {\it Mathematica}. As an example, the usefulness of this program is demonstrated by proving the finite temperature Ward identity for QED in a second order effective theory.
